In the ruthlessness of the prosecutors and the eagerness of neighbor to testify against neighbor, the crucible mirrors the anticommunist hysteria in the 1950s. Miller wrote the play to warn against mass hysteria and to plead for freedom and tolerance. Like most longer works, the crucible has several themes. Arthur miller, who lived through the mccarthy era and wrote the crucible about the witch trials, saw that both were driven by the intense fear of change and the unknown.
